Modern Addition to Historic Docks

26.04.21

Abode2 looks around the newly unveiled Saffron Wharf, a new collection of homes - designed by renowned architects Patel Taylor and heralding to the docks’ heritage – forming part of a vibrant new community.

Proud to be a part of historic Wapping, London Dock is one of the most prominent Central London developments, offering a variety of residential and commercial property as well as open public spaces. Delivered by St George – part of the Berkeley Group – and designed by renowned architects Patel Taylor, London Dock has been created to honour its history in every detail. Since first launching, the 15-acre mixed use development has gone from strength to strength, with many Londoners choosing to call this part of Wapping home.

Moments from the Tower of London and the River Thames itself, London Dock expertly weaves the city’s history with modern-day luxuries. It has a grand history: the docks, first open in 1805, historically accommodated up to 500 ships and over 200,000 tonnes of goods, and once posed as Britain’s gateway to both the New and Old Worlds.

Saffron Wharf will be the next chapter of this dynamic new neighbourhood of 1,800 homes. Playing on the maritime and trading history of the area, the chapter typifies just what happens when old and new luxuries combine.

The backdrop of several Dickens novels – and with the essence of spices, coffee and cocoa – the St George and Patel Taylor teams have brought this historical piece of London back to life. Today, it is alive not with the sounds of traders and merchants, but of those who live, work and play there.

Launching in April, Saffron Wharf takes its name and inspiration from one of the most opulent products traded at the docks.

Saffron Wharf stands at a striking 18 storeys, and has been designed to ensure that every home has its own private balcony where residents can take in vistas of boulevards, courtyard gardens, Canary Wharf or the City.

Alongside Saffron Wharf, the 300 metre long, Grade II listed Pennington Street Warehouse is being refurbished to create inspirational spaces – brought to life by exposed brick walls and archways, light-flooded spaces, and high ceilings.

Around Pennington Quay Walk and central piazza, Gauging Square, new bars and eateries are waiting for discovery. Champagne Route, an artisan champagne bar, and 9Round, a boutique boxing gym, sit within Gauging Square, with more exciting new tenants in the pipeline. The water feature within Gauging Square, for instance, is a place of reflection – inspired by the Miroir d’eau at the Place de le Bourse.

Residents of Saffron Wharf additionally benefit from an impressive range of private facilities: a state-of-the-art gym, a heated pool, a sauna, steam room, jacuzzi, squash court, cinema room, virtual golf suite, and a 24-hour concierge.
